Bumble Inc (BMBL) - Total Liabilities
Latest total liabilities as of September 2025: $1.16 Billion USD
Based on the latest financial reports, Bumble Inc (BMBL) has total liabilities worth $1.16 Billion USD as of September 2025.
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ities.

Liquidity & Leverage Metrics
Key Metrics Explained
| Metric |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Current Ratio | 3.55 |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Quick Ratio | N/A | More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Cash Ratio | N/A |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Debt to Equity | 1.71 |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ity) |
| Debt to Assets | 0.53 |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ets) |

Annual Total Liabilities for Bumble Inc (2018–2024)
The table below shows the annual total liabilities of Bumble Inc from 2018 to 2024.
| Year | Total Liabilities |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2024-12-31 | $1.18 Billion | -8.70% |
| 2023-12-31 | $1.29 Billion | +3.94% |
| 2022-12-31 | $1.24 Billion | -5.22% |
| 2021-12-31 | $1.31 Billion | -15.80% |
| 2020-12-31 | $1.55 Billion | +759.55% |
| 2019-12-31 | $180.62 Million | +18.87% |
| 2018-12-31 | $151.95 Million | -- |
